Job Scope for Buyer/Planner:
The Buyer/Planner plans and controls materials requirements and purchases to support the continuous flow and delivery of product to the customer at the highest quality and lowest total cost. Works with the global sourcing organization and the materials manager to develop and execute business strategies impacting supply chain consolidation, cost reduction, quality improvement as well as supplier assessment and associated scorecard activities.
Responsibilities for Buyer/Planner:
- For assigned portfolio of items optimize inventory level across multiple distribution centers and achieve customer on time delivery goals
- Issue purchase orders and work orders in support of distribution plans and customer requirements. Expedite/de-expedite orders as needed. Work directly with assigned suppliers to obtain product and service information, availability and delivery schedule
- Review the site-level demand forecasts by SKU and work with forecast analyst to ensure forecast accuracy
- Maintain accurate system data, such as bills of material, purchase costs, lead times, etc.
- Identify and implement key areas of opportunity to drive aggregate cost and quality improvements. May be done in conjunction with company-wide sourcing activities
- Resolve supplier invoice discrepancies and coordinate disposition of non-conforming material

It all began when William R. Kelly—founder of the temporary staffing industry—established Kelly Services® in 1946. The company's traditional expertise started with office services, call center, light industrial, and electronic assembly staffing. Through the years, we expanded our expertise and established a proven record of successfully matching job seekers to opportunities in disciplines such as science, engineering, law, education, healthcare, IT, and finance. As a Fortune 500® company, Kelly® has evolved into a global workforce solutions leader, making employment connections for nearly half a million people around the world every year.
